Date: Monday, November 27, 2017 @ 08:32:26 Author: eworm Revision: 269492
upgpkg: virtualbox-modules-arch 5.2.2-4 restore install script for depmod Added: virtualbox-modules-arch/trunk/virtualbox-modules-arch.install Modified: virtualbox-modules-arch/trunk/PKGBUILD ---------------------------------+ PKGBUILD | 6 ++++-- virtualbox-modules-arch.install | 18 ++++++++++++++++++ 2 files changed, 22 insertions(+), 2 deletions(-) Modified: PKGBUILD =================================================================== --- PKGBUILD 2017-11-27 08:32:25 UTC (rev 269491) +++ PKGBUILD 2017-11-27 08:32:26 UTC (rev 269492) @@ -5,9 +5,9 @@ pkgbase=virtualbox-modules-arch pkgname=('virtualbox-host-modules-arch' 'virtualbox-guest-modules-arch') pkgver=5.2.2 -pkgrel=3 +pkgrel=4 _linux_major=4 -_linux_minor=14 +_linux_minor=13 arch=('x86_64') url='http://virtualbox.org' license=('GPL') @@ -29,6 +29,7 @@ conflicts=('virtualbox-modules' 'virtualbox-host-modules' 'virtualbox-host-dkms') provides=('VIRTUALBOX-HOST-MODULES') + install=virtualbox-modules-arch.install cd "/var/lib/dkms/vboxhost/${pkgver}_OSE/$_kernver/$CARCH/module" install -Dt "$pkgdir/usr/lib/modules/$_extramodules" -m644 * @@ -51,6 +52,7 @@ conflicts=('virtualbox-archlinux-modules' 'virtualbox-guest-modules' 'virtualbox-guest-dkms') provides=('VIRTUALBOX-GUEST-MODULES') + install=virtualbox-modules-arch.install cd "/var/lib/dkms/vboxguest/${pkgver}_OSE/$_kernver/$CARCH/module" install -Dt "$pkgdir/usr/lib/modules/$_extramodules" -m644 * Added: virtualbox-modules-arch.install =================================================================== --- virtualbox-modules-arch.install (rev 0) +++ virtualbox-modules-arch.install 2017-11-27 08:32:26 UTC (rev 269492) @@ -0,0 +1,18 @@ +#!/bin/sh + +_depmod() { + EXTRAMODULES=extramodules-4.13-ARCH + depmod $(cat /usr/lib/modules/$EXTRAMODULES/version) +} + +post_install() { + _depmod +} + +post_upgrade() { + _depmod +} + +post_remove() { + _depmod +}